We study the Whitham equations for all the higher order KdV equations. The Whitham equations are neither strictly hyperbolic nor genuinely nonlinear. We are interested in the solution of the Whitham equations when the initial values are given by a step function.
We have presented a new hyperbolic auxiliary function method for obtaining traveling wave solutions of nonlinear partial differential equations. Applying this, exact traveling wave solutions for the coupled Sine-Gordon equations are constructed.
We show how to use variational methods to prove two diierent results: Existence of periodic solutions with irrational periods of some hyperbolic equations in one dimension and existence of spatially quasi-periodic solutions of some elliptic equations .
